Berger and Cirasella describe predatory OA journals as journals that exist for the sole purpose of profit, not the dissemination of high-quality research findings and furtherance of knowledge. More recently, Grudniewicz and colleagues developed this definition: Predatory journals and publishers are entities that prioritize self-interest at the expense of scholarship and are characterized by false or misleading information, deviation from best editorial and publication practices, a lack of transparency, and/or the use of aggressive and indiscriminate solicitation practices.. The firs list, Bealls List of Predatory Journals and Publishers, was created by an academic librarian, Jeffery Beall, and is now maintained and updated by an anonymous source.8 Bealls criteria for selection of questionable online journals include high publication fees and limited peer-review and editorial processes. Predatory Journals: A Potential Threat to Nursing Practice and Science Characteristics associated with emails suspected of being predatory included the presence of obvious spelling and/or grammar errors (90.2%), a salutation including the word greetings (60.4%; e.g., Greetings of the day, Greetings from, Warm greetings), an offer to submit a broad range of document/article categories (53.3%; e.g., including research or review articles, case reports, editorials, clinical images, letters to editors), and/or the use of excessively flattering language (46.7%; Table 3). . Nurses should not use Google and Google Scholar only for a search because predatory publications can be found via these search engines, and there is no assurance of the accuracy of the information.
